Add code style rule for multiple return types

pull/27452/head
David Baker 2024-05-09 10:42:26 +01:00
parent 02fd35dad0
commit 3a159beb21
1 changed files with 4 additions and 0 deletions

View File

@ -224,6 +224,10 @@ Unless otherwise specified, the following applies to all code:
// ... // ...
} }
``` ```
37. Avoid functions whose behaviour / return type varies with different parameter types.
Multiple return types are fine when appropriate (eg. SDKConfig.get() with a string param which
returns the type according to the param given) but SDKConfig.get() with no args returning the
whole config object is not: this could just be a separate function.
## React ## React